A FRENCH SMALL-SWORD
Early 19th Century
With etched, blued and gilt blade of hollow triangular section, gilt-brass hilt with shell-guard cast and chased in relief with an eagle displayed and thunderbolts, mother-of-pearl grips, and flattened pommel with a bee in relief on each side
30in. (76.2cm.) blade
Provenance
Sir Cecil Beaton, C.B.E., Reddish House, Broadchalke, Wiltshire, 10 June 1980, lot 352
